gpt4 book ai didi

python - Bokeh 中轴类型日期时间的矩形散点图

转载 作者:行者123 更新时间:2023-11-30 23:16:57 25 4
gpt4 key购买 nike

Bokeh 中轴类型日期时间的矩形散点图

我想创建一个 x 轴类型为 datetime 的绘图。作为示例,我使用了具有正方形和视觉变量大小的函数 scatter

import datetime
from bokeh.plotting import *

figure(x_axis_type="datetime")
scatter([d1,d2,d3], [1,5,3], size=[10,20,30], marker="square")
show()

作为第二个可视化,我将用矩形替换正方形并使用视觉变量宽度和高度。由于单位划分,我看不到宽度。这个问题有解决办法吗(除了将宽度乘以一个因子)?我可以创建一个新标记吗?

figure(x_axis_type="datetime")
rect([d1,d2,d3], [1,5,3], [1,2,3], [5,1,2])
show()

注意:我使用的是 Python v.2.7.8Bokeh v.0.7.0

最佳答案

您应该能够在对 rect 的调用中设置 width_units="screen",然后设置宽度(以像素为单位)。另请注意,API 使用形式已被弃用,请考虑:

p = figure(x_axis_type="datetime")
p.rect([d1,d2,d3], [1,5,3], [1,2,3], [5,1,2])
show(p)

关于python - Bokeh 中轴类型日期时间的矩形散点图,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27521795/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com